A resident of Mount Royal for over 50 years, Luigi Tiengo is a true master of watercolor. Born in 1926 in Adria, Veneto, Italy, Tiengo’s talent for drawing was recognized by his father, who enrolled him in classes with one of the region’s finest painters, Antonio Tumiati. Simultaneously, he pursued studies in industrial design. Arriving in Canada in 1956, he embarked on an award-winning career in furniture design. Then, in 1971, he dedicated himself full-time to his passion for painting. Canada instilled in him a joy and enthusiasm that are beautifully reflected in his works. Tiengo’s subjects vary, inspired by the places of his childhood, his travels,
and his current residence. His paintings have been featured in over 25 solo exhibitions in Quebec and Europe. In 1982, along with 12 other artists, he founded the Canadian Society of Painters in Water Colour. In 1995, Ed. Broquet published “Signed by L. Tiengo,” a 104-page book of his works.
